PBL Paint Coating is real easy to use and lasts about 3 times as long as PBL Sealant. I have both, but I use the Coating (except once). I bought the sealant and the Coating at the same time. (Actually, both the Paint Coating and the Surface coating). I figured I had already used other sealants and liked them (Zaino and Klasse) so I would try the PBL Sealant since it was supposed to have twice the life of just about any other sealant. I used it on one car - my daughter's. Then I used the surface coating on wheels and windows and liked it so much I used the paint coating on my wife's car.

I would recommend the paint coating over the sealant any day of the week - and I am a sealant kind of guy (I still use sealants on my personal DD because longevity isn't as important to me there).
